Study Summary

The inflatable penile prosthesis (IPP) is the gold standard for surgical management of erectile dysfunction (ED) and there is no consensus on the best postoperative pain management regimen. In the wake of the opioid epidemic, postoperative pain management is heavily scrutinized. The National Institute of Health estimated over 81,000 individuals died following overdose of any opioids in 2022 alone; of these, over 14,000 deaths were linked to prescription opioids. Thus, strategies to minimize postoperative pain should not only improve patient experience but also lessen the need to escalate to opioid usage.

Primary Outcome

VAS scores range from 0 to 100, with 0 representing no pain or the least desirable state and 100 representing the worst possible pain or the most desirable state. The "score" is the distance in millimeters from the "no pain" end of the 100mm line to the point where the person marks their pain level. Lower scores (0-4mm) indicate no pain, while higher scores (75-100mm) indicate severe pain.
